EMME proves she is a “Girl’s Girl” with new indie pop single

Date:

LA native singer-songwriter EMME is back with her newest single “Girl’s Girl.”

“Girl’s Girl” is an upbeat indie pop track driven by punchy drums and a soaring sax solo. Written after a falling out that turned a friendship into a competition, it reclaims the joy of supporting other women. Inspired by MUNA, HAIM, and Maisie Peters, the song pairs playful, sharp lyrics with bright, feel-good energy. It’s made for windows-down drives, getting ready with friends, and reclaiming your confidence.

EMME is an artist known for hooky pop melodies and relatable storytelling. She began her music career by writing for other artists such as Grace VanderWaal and JORDY. She is now focused on her solo project, creating music that explores a range of perspectives.
